Balmerol Synthgear MR Series is fully synthetic industrial gear / circulating oil developed for maximum protection of gears and bearings operating under severe conditions and extremes of application temperature. Balmerol Synthgear MR Series is fortified with Anti-micropitting additives and its selective additive system provides protection against scuffing wear and micropitting due to fatigue. The high viscosity index of these products ensure optimum viscosity both at high and low temperatures, which not only provide wider operating temperature range but also ensures equipment protection at extreme temperatures by providing sufficient oil film.

Features & Benefits:

  • Protection against micropitting, providing excellent protection of gears and bearings at extreme scuffing wear conditions, meeting various OEM requirements.
  • High Viscosity Index, ensuring optimum viscosity/film thickness at operating temperatures for better equipment protection at both low and high temperatures.
  • Wider operating temperature range, contributing to excellent oxidation and thermal stability.
  • Longer oil drain interval and lower oil consumption, enhancing overall equipment performance and promoting cleaner operation.
  • High load carrying characteristics, offering better protection of equipment under heavy/shock loads.
  • Very good rust and corrosion protection, leading to lower maintenance costs and better protection of bearings.

Applications / Recommendations:

  • Recommended for use in industrial gears and bearings operating under extreme conditions—temperature, pressure, shock loads, etc.
  • Compatible with metallic materials as well as elastomeric seals.
  • Balmerol Synthgear MR 320/460 are suitable for use in wind turbine gearboxes.
